Updated 20 June 2001 The RemarksSticking high above the valley and often the cloud The Remarkables dominates the Wakatipu Basin. Shorn by glaciers, draped in snow, one of Queenstown's great play grounds :-) The Remarkables snow area sits in the Rastus Burn facing brilliantly North for those sunny days and high altitude snow fun. A great spot for the family with young kids. Uncrowded gentle slopes and a nice big learners area just in front of the impressive day lodge. The lifts provide access to some stunning advanced terrain above Lake Alta with the well known Escalator, Elevator and Inclinator chutes. Or get those legs burning on Homeward Bound.

Vital statistics |
|
| Height at summit | 2 324m |
| Highest Lift Point | 1 957 metres / 6 419 feet |
| Vertical drop | 357 metres / 1 170 feet |
| Lifts | 2 quad chairs, 1 double chair, 2 fixed grips, 1 magic carpet |
| Average Snow Fall | 3.1 metres |
| Snowmaking | 5 guns |
| Terrain area | 220 hectares |
| Terrain grades | 30% beginner, 40% intermediate, 30% advanced |
